Streator, Illinois Climate Data

Streator, Illinois has a Humid Continental Hot Summers With Year Around Precipitation climate (Köppen classification: Dfa). Average annual temperatures range from 41 °F (low) to 60.7 °F (high). Annual precipitation averages 38.6 Inches. Streator is located in USDA Plant Hardiness Zone 5b. The growing season typically runs from the last frost around Apr. 21 - Apr. 30 through the first frost around Oct. 11 - Oct. 20.

Monthly Average Climate Data for Streator, Illinois

Average monthly temperatures and precipitation Switch to Celsius / Metric
MonthAvg. LowAvg. HighAvg. Precip
January15.8 °F31.6 °F2.08 in.
February19.2 °F36.2 °F1.88 in.
March28.9 °F48.6 °F2.62 in.
April39.4 °F61.9 °F3.67 in.
May51.1 °F72.7 °F4.66 in.
June60.7 °F81.5 °F4.56 in.
July64.4 °F84.5 °F4.01 in.
August62.2 °F82.6 °F3.72 in.
September54.1 °F77.3 °F3.5 in.
October42.6 °F65.0 °F3.01 in.
November31.6 °F49.5 °F2.69 in.
December21.6 °F36.9 °F2.15 in.
Annual41 °F60.7 °F38.55 in.
